Sidharth Bhardwaj, a familiar face from shows like Splitsvilla 2 and Bigg Boss 5, has revealed his return to reality television after a substantial absence.
He has chosen to participate in the upcoming show 'The 50,' citing its distinct and chaotic format as a primary draw. Bhardwaj expressed his attraction to the show's novel approach in India, stating he thrives in such unpredictable environments.
Bhardwaj also observed that 'The 50' incorporates elements reminiscent of his previous reality show experiences, particularly the alliance dynamics seen in Splitsvilla and the overall structure akin to Bigg Boss.
Looking back, he considers himself among the few contestants who experienced formative eras of Bigg Boss, Splitsvilla, and Roadies. These early ventures, he feels, imparted valuable lessons on maintaining composure and strategic thinking.
His decision to step away from reality TV for years after Bigg Boss 5, despite a stint on Fear Factor, was motivated by a desire to avoid roles perceived as lesser in scale. He also consciously shifted focus to acting in web series and films to prevent being typecast.
Regarding the viral nature of reality TV moments and meme culture, Bhardwaj remains unfazed, viewing such instances as transient and part of the professional journey.
